摘要:
Gas reservoirs are finite materials, so the exploitation of gas fields is equivalent to doing arithmetic problems,trying to ensure that the difference between reserves and output is not zero.Once the difference between gas reservoir reserves and production becomes zero, it means that the life of the gas field is coming to an end.
In many cases, what makes the life of a gas field come to an end ahead of schedule is not that the reserves of the gasreservoir have been exhausted, but that the gas field water is causing trouble.After reaching a peak, the production period of many old gas fields often slides downwards at an alarming rate of decline.This is mostly due to the burden of water on the gas wells.
